Catalino R Obra 1909 - 1977

Catalino Rimando Obra of Alameda County, California United States was born on April 30, 1909 in San Fernando, La Union Philippine Islands to Tomas Obra and Cipriano Rimando. He married Teresita Llanos Obra, and had children Catalino Rimando Obra Jr, Richard Llanos Obra, Leonard Llanos Obra, Ruben Llanos Obra, Robert Llanos Obra, and Emelita Llanos Obra. Catalino Obra died at age 68 years old in 1977 in Oakland.

  • Military Service

    Military serial#: 39838733 Enlisted: May 3, 1946 in San Francisco California Military branch: Air Corps Rank: Private First Class, Regular Army (including Officers, Nurses, Warrant Officers, And Enlisted Men) Terms of enlistment: Enlistment For Hawaiian Department

In 1909, in the year that Catalino R Obra was born, the U.S. penny was changed to the Abraham Lincoln design. The Lincoln penny was so popular that it soon had to be rationed and it sold on the secondary market for a quarter. Abraham Lincoln was the first historical figure to be on a U.S. coin - which was released to commemorate his 100th birthday. This penny was also the first U.S. cent to include the words "In God We Trust.".
